About me
I'm in my forties, and I've played roleplaying games since the late nineties. I've been GMing for most of that time. I'm autistic and LGBTQ+, and am a welcoming geek about comic books, sci-fi, superheroes, and gaming.
GM Style
I favor rules-light systems as a GM, but I can (and do) run stuff like D&D 5e and Fantasy AGE. I tend to favor rule-of-cool and simple solutions to gameplay rather that sweating all the complex details. I want to keep things moving and fun. Dramatic tension, character interaction, and humor are all important in my games. Also, I'm an amateur voice actor in audio dramas, so I bring a flair for character voices into my sessions as a GM. Games I like to run that are not listed in StartPlaying include Lasers & Feelings (and various hacks thereof), For the Honor, and Daggerheart.
